Como Prevenir o Apodrecimento do CLAUDE.md: Trate Regras Como Código

✍️ OpenClawRadar📅 Publicado: May 8, 2026🔗 Source
Como Prevenir o Apodrecimento do CLAUDE.md: Trate Regras Como Código
Ad

Após executar o Claude Code em projetos de produção por 18 meses, u/mm_cm_m_km identificou o ponto de falha mais comum: o arquivo CLAUDE.md apodrece. Não porque Claude o ignora, mas porque os desenvolvedores continuam adicionando regras sem nunca limpá-las. O resultado é um arquivo inflado de 500 linhas que custa tokens a cada turno e fica fora de sincronia com a base de código real.

1. CLAUDE.md como um Índice, Não um Manual

Mantenha CLAUDE.md com 30 a 50 linhas. Ele deve atuar como um sumário apontando para arquivos específicos para preocupações específicas — não uma parede de todas as preferências que você já definiu. Claude relê o arquivo a cada turno; arquivos curtos são baratos, arquivos longos desperdiçam tokens e atenção.

2. Cada Seção Responde a Uma de Duas Perguntas

  • Qual comportamento você deseja? (a regra) — pertence ao CLAUDE.md.
  • Onde você encontra a verdade atual? (a fonte) — pertence como uma URL ou caminho de arquivo buscável que Claude pode reler no momento da tarefa.

Misturar regras e fontes é como os arquivos crescem sem limites. Mantenha a regra curta, a fonte externa.

Ad

3. Audite Antes do Merge, Não Depois

As regras silenciosamente se desviam à medida que você renomeia coisas, refatora hooks ou elimina recursos. A correção não é "ser mais cuidadoso" — é uma etapa de CI. O autor construiu um aplicativo GitHub chamado agentlint (agentlint.net) que audita a superfície das regras a cada PR: contradições entre arquivos, referências a caminhos deletados, regras descrevendo recursos de harness que sua versão não suporta.

4. Delete Mais do Que Adiciona

Quase todo CLAUDE.md ganha uma nova regra por semana e deleta zero. Depois de seis meses, você tem um Frankenstein. A disciplina: para cada nova regra, encontre uma para deletar. Isso manteve o arquivo do autor abaixo de 100 linhas.

O padrão central: trate sua superfície de regras como código. Código tem testes, revisão e detecção de desvios. Regras precisam do mesmo.

📖 Leia a fonte completa: r/ClaudeAI

Ad

👀 See Also

Plugin OpenClaw Minimalismo: Ferramentas Principais Lidam com 95% das Tarefas
Tips

Plugin OpenClaw Minimalismo: Ferramentas Principais Lidam com 95% das Tarefas

Um desenvolvedor executando o OpenClaw em produção relata que desabilitar plugins não essenciais e substituir os críticos por scripts simples resultou em inicialização 40% mais rápida, uso de memória 60% menor e zero atualizações quebradas ao longo de quatro meses.

OpenClawRadar
Carregar todo servidor MCP em todo prompt silenciosamente destrói o orçamento de tokens
Tips

Carregar todo servidor MCP em todo prompt silenciosamente destrói o orçamento de tokens

Um usuário com 5 a 6 servidores MCP descobriu que cada prompt carregava todos os servidores, causando um desperdício massivo de tokens. A implementação de uma camada de roteamento para carregar apenas os servidores relevantes por prompt reduziu drasticamente o uso de tokens e melhorou os tempos de resposta.

OpenClawRadar
Dicas Práticas de Fluxo de Trabalho com Claude Code para Projetos de Desenvolvimento Complexos
Tips

Dicas Práticas de Fluxo de Trabalho com Claude Code para Projetos de Desenvolvimento Complexos

Um usuário do Claude Pro compartilha estratégias específicas de fluxo de trabalho para desenvolver plugins de áudio complexos, incluindo o uso do modo de planejamento para recursos principais, criação de arquivos de contexto, gerenciamento de uso de tokens e implementação de etapas de validação.

OpenClawRadar
Maximize Suas Economias: Executando Bots OpenClaw com Orçamento Limitado
Tips

Maximize Suas Economias: Executando Bots OpenClaw com Orçamento Limitado

Explore maneiras de executar o OpenClaw/ClawdBot/MoltBot gratuitamente ou com orçamento limitado, aproveitando dicas da comunidade e estratégias engenhosas compartilhadas no r/openclaw.

OpenClawRadar